The Sales Letter for Furriers is a professional correspondence designed for fur retailers to communicate with new customers. This form helps businesses introduce their services related to fur maintenance and storage, distinguishing it from other sales letters by its focus on the specific care required for fur garments in humid climates. By using this letter, furriers can effectively inform potential clients about the importance of proper fur care and storage solutions.
This sales letter should be used when a furrier wants to reach out to new clients, particularly those who have recently moved to areas with high humidity levels. It is suitable for use during promotional periods, seasonal changes, or whenever a new clientâs attention is required to encourage the safe storage and maintenance of their fur garments.

What is a sales letter? A sales letter is a form of direct marketing that's designed to attract potential customers to your product or service. It tells new prospects who you are and how your company can benefit them.
Elements and Format of Sales Letter Introduction: It is the introductory paragraph. Introduction in the sales letter provides the details of the product or the service. It also provides the reader with the cost, quality, saving and other related information. Body: Here the writer builds his credibility.
The "four A's" of sales letters are attention, appeal, application, and action. First, get the reader's attention. Next, highlight your product's appeal. Then, show the reader the product's application.
How to write a sales letter Write a catchy headline that grabs your customer's attention.Hook the reader by identifying what they need and why.Include bullet points with key information.Use testimonials or statistics.Give readers a call to action.Offer something to the customer that is limited in time or quantity.

In this section, the following characteristics of the language of sales letters will be examined: Customer-centredness. Positive expressions. Personal and informal tone. Being easy to understand. Rhetorical questions. Interesting adjectives. Making follow-up action sound easy. The Imperative.
Sales Letter: A sales letter is a piece of direct mail which is designed to persuade the reader to purchase a particular product or service in the absence of a salesman.
AIDA is the most commonly used technique to write a sales letter that will always work.
